My expectations weren't all that high but this movie sucks in so many ways that it nearly hurt to watch it. Let's face it: It IS entirely possible to make a really good post- apocalyptic movie on a really limited budget but that would require a couple of prerequisites that this film crew was lacking - you would have to have an interesting script, acted well by decent actors and a director/editor ready to spend weeks editing the accomplished product. Of these this film has NONE. It felt like I was watching a high school art class production, and certainly not made by the top students either. There has rarely been a time in the last 44 years when I thought to myself "life is too short for this kind of godawful crap" and quit watching halfway through the film but yes, I couldn't possibly finish this one. I cannot recommend this to anyone, not even out of curiosity and since it just sucks it isn't even comedically bad, just sad. The props and costumes are quite well done but that doesn't save the show when the acting is on par with old German porn videos (and if you have never had the displeasure of stumbling onto one, let's just say that they were not paid for their acting skills).
